piipes Wrote:Ati hd5770: No Dxva, and that is problem Smile How i can eneble hardware deinterlacing with ati and mpeg2 file?

Ati officially doesn't have mpeg-2 bitstream decoding support. There are registry hacks to enable this, but I have not seen any success reports. Sad

If I have the time I will look into how to provide DXVA deinterlacing for software decoded material, but I am quite busy lately.
